1. 下载Opencv,安装
2. 配置环境变量
1、系统变量 Path:添加D:opencvopencv-2.4.9opencvuildx86vc12in
2、用户变量:添加opencv变量,值D:opencvopencv-2.4.9opencvuildx86vc12in变量值实际为bin文件夹的路径;
说明:不管你系统是32位还是64位,路径目录均选择X86,因为编译都是使用32位编译;如果选用X64,则程序运行时候会出错。
重启!
3. VS工程设置:
1, 在项目->属性对话框中,左侧“配置”选择“Debug”,然后“配置属性”->VC++目录,在右侧设置“包含目录”,新添加:
D:opencvopencv-2.4.9opencvuildinclude
D:opencvopencv-2.4.9opencvuildincludeopencv
D:opencvopencv-2.4.9opencvuildincludeopencv2
2, 在“库目录”,添加:
D:opencvopencv-2.4.9opencvuildx86vc12lib
3,【通用属性】 ->【链接器】->【输入】->【附加的依赖项】
debug:
opencv_ml249d.lib
opencv_calib3d249d.lib
opencv_contrib249d.lib
opencv_core249d.lib
opencv_features2d249d.lib
opencv_flann249d.lib
opencv_gpu249d.lib
opencv_highgui249d.lib
opencv_imgproc249d.lib
opencv_legacy249d.lib
opencv_objdetect249d.lib
opencv_ts249d.lib
opencv_video249d.lib
opencv_nonfree249d.lib
opencv_ocl249d.lib
opencv_photo249d.lib
opencv_stitching249d.lib
opencv_superres249d.lib
opencv_videostab249d.lib
Release:
opencv_ml249.lib
opencv_calib3d249.lib
opencv_contrib249.lib
opencv_core249.lib
opencv_features2d249.lib
opencv_flann249.lib
opencv_gpu249.lib
opencv_highgui249.lib
opencv_imgproc249.lib
opencv_legacy249.lib
opencv_objdetect249.lib
opencv_ts249.lib
opencv_video249.lib
opencv_nonfree249.lib
opencv_ocl249.lib
opencv_photo249.lib
opencv_stitching249.lib
opencv_superres249.lib
opencv_videostab249.lib